Theoretical foundations: why badges influence behavior

The psychology of badges is rooted in multiple established theories. Understanding these frameworks clarifies when badges will be motivating and when they will be superficial.

Below are the core theories explaining badge effects, each with a short explanation and implications for badge design.

Reinforcement learning and operant conditioning

Badges act as discrete rewards in a reinforcement schedule. When a badge reliably follows a specific behavior, it functions like a token reward that strengthens that behavior over time. In practice, intermittent and variable reinforcement (random or tiered badges) often sustains engagement longer than constant rewards.

Implication: Use badges to reinforce clear, measurable actions and consider variable schedules to maintain interest without inflating reward cost.

Self-determination theory: autonomy, competence, relatedness

Self-determination theory explains why badges can either support intrinsic motivation or undermine it. Badges that communicate genuine competence and enable social relatedness without reducing perceived autonomy tend to enhance sustained motivation.

Implication: Design badges that acknowledge skill growth and peer recognition rather than controlling or micromanaging behavior.

Social comparison and status signaling

Badges provide visible status cues that drive social comparison. In teams where status and peer recognition matter, badges can accelerate adoption. Conversely, in teams that value privacy, collaboration, or egalitarianism, badges can produce resentment.

Implication: Make badges optional or private in contexts where public ranking undermines trust or teamwork.

Goal-setting and feedback loops

Badges provide explicit targets and immediate feedback, which align with goal-setting theory. Clear, proximal badges (daily or weekly achievements) help employees perceive progress and maintain momentum toward larger KPIs.

Implication: Structure badge hierarchies around meaningful milestones and ensure they connect to organizational goals.

  • Key takeaway: The most effective badges combine reinforcement, competence signals, and clear goals while respecting autonomy and team norms.
  • Key takeaway: Theoretical fit matters: match badge mechanics to the dominant motivational drivers in the target group.

How organizational context moderates badge impact

The impact of the psychology of badges depends heavily on organizational context. Two teams with similar tasks can react differently to the same badge program because of differences in KPIs, risk tolerance, leadership signals, and cultural norms.

Below are the primary contextual moderators leaders should assess before designing badges.

KPIs and outcome visibility

Badges that map directly to high-visibility KPIs (sales closed, CSAT scores, code reviews merged) are more persuasive than badges tied to low-value activities (logins, forum posts). Visibility amplifies value: when leadership references badges in reviews, they gain legitimacy.

Action: Audit KPIs and prioritize badges that tie to metrics already used in performance conversations.

Autonomy and decision space

Teams with high autonomy (R&D, product) respond better to badges that endorse experimentation and mastery. Highly process-driven teams (compliance, finance) may view badges as distractions unless they reinforce risk controls and accuracy.

Action: Tailor badge mechanics to the team's decision authority and workflow; preserve autonomy by allowing badge choices or pathways.

Risk tolerance and error sensitivity

Badges that incentivize speed can clash with groups where errors are costly. In finance and compliance, the psychology of badges must prioritize quality over throughput.

Action: Use penalty-avoiding badges (accuracy streaks) and balance speed incentives with quality checks.

Social norms and hierarchy

Organizations with strong hierarchical norms may see badges used as status instruments; flatter cultures may reject visible rankings. Privacy controls and group-specific leaderboards help mitigate tension.

Action: Survey attitudes toward public recognition before enabling visible leaderboards.

Why do badges motivate employees in some teams and not others?

What differentiates winners from losers in badge rollouts is not the badges themselves but the match between badge design and team motivation. The psychology of badges explains three central pathways to motivation and one pathway to failure.

When badges speak to a team's dominant motivational pathway—competence, autonomy, or relatedness—they succeed.

What drives a team: competence, autonomy, or relatedness?

Ask: Are team members primarily motivated by mastery and skill (competence), control over how they work (autonomy), or social belonging and recognition (relatedness)? Badges that map to the primary driver earn far more buy-in.

Quick diagnostic:

  • If mastery matters, use skill-tiered badges and private progress bars.
  • If autonomy matters, offer multiple badge tracks and opt-outs.
  • If relatedness matters, emphasize social badges and peer-nominated awards.

Why do badges motivate employees in sales but not in R&D?

Sales often operate under clear KPIs, high visibility, and a culture that rewards public achievement. The psychology of badges aligns naturally: badges signal status, drive competition, and map to commission-driven goals. R&D, by contrast, values experimentation, long-term outcomes, and intrinsic problem-solving. Public badges that reward surface metrics can feel trivial and harm creativity.

Design note: In R&D, use badges for learning milestones, code craftsmanship, or mentorship rather than call-volume analogs.

Decision framework: when to use badges

Deploying badges without a framework is a common cause of failure. Below is a practical decision tree to decide whether and how to use badges, followed by an implementation checklist.

We recommend a short assessment and an MVP pilot before enterprise rollout.

Four-step decision tree

  1. Map the target behavior to a meaningful KPI. If no clear KPI exists, reassess the need for a badge.
  2. Diagnose the team's dominant motivators (competence/autonomy/relatedness).
  3. Design badge mechanics that respect error sensitivity and workflow friction.
  4. Pilot with a controlled group and measure both behavior and sentiment.

If two or more answers are negative, do not launch badges yet. Refine the behavior, measurement, or cultural fit first.

How to scope a pilot

Keep pilots small and timeboxed (4–8 weeks). Identify a single, high-leverage behavior, create 2–4 badge types (progress, mastery, social, and streak), and use pre/post surveys to capture sentiment. Include a control group for rigorous comparison.

Measurement baseline: pre-intervention behavior rate, desired KPI, and qualitative feedback from participants.

Measuring impact: metrics and evaluation

Measurement is where many badge programs fail: leaders report impressive early uptake but no sustained impact on outcomes. To avoid this, measure both proximal behaviors and distal outcomes.

Combine quantitative A/B testing with qualitative feedback to understand not just whether badges change behavior but why.

Primary metrics to track

  • Behavioral adoption: participation rate, badge issuance rate, daily/weekly active participants.
  • Outcome alignment: change in KPI tied to badges (e.g., conversion rate, CSAT, error rate).
  • Quality signals: error rate, rework, customer complaints.
  • Engagement health: retention of participants across weeks, churn from badge program.
  • Sentiment: NPS or short surveys about perceived fairness and value.

Experiment design and causal inference

Run randomized controlled trials where possible. If randomization is infeasible, use matched controls and difference-in-differences analysis. Track short-term spikes vs long-term sustained change — badges that only drive short-lived behavior changes often indicate extrinsic motivation without internalization.

Tip: Measure unintended consequences like metric gaming and changes in cross-team collaboration.

Common failure modes and how to fix them

Understanding typical failure modes helps teams anticipate problems and build mitigations into the design.

Below are the most common issues and specific fixes based on practical experience.

Low adoption

Symptoms: low opt-in, badges ignored, minimal change in behavior.

  • Fix: Increase perceived value by aligning badges to performance reviews or learning credits.
  • Fix: Reduce friction to claim badges and publicize early wins via internal champions.

Perceived triviality

Symptoms: employees describe badges as "sticker" or "childish."

  • Fix: Elevate badge meaning—tie to skill mastery, certificates, or career pathways.
  • Fix: Use tiered badges that show progression from novice to expert.

Metric gaming

Symptoms: behaviors shift toward badge-earning at the expense of quality or customer experience.

  • Fix: Pair throughput badges with quality guards (sample audits, penalty badges for errors).
  • Fix: Use composite badges that require multiple evidence streams (e.g., volume + CSAT).

Visibility backlash

Symptoms: resentment, reduced collaboration, public shaming.

  • Fix: Offer privacy settings, team-level leaderboards, or opt-in public recognition.
  • Fix: Facilitate peer-nomination badges to emphasize positive social recognition.

Design patterns and departmental examples

Design patterns translate theory into repeatable templates. Below are patterns mapped to departmental needs with short case sketches for Sales, Customer Support, HR, Finance, and R&D.

Each pattern notes why it works from the psychology of badges perspective and the pitfalls to avoid.

Sales — Competitive mastery pattern

Pattern: Public rank badges for top performers + tiered milestones for repeatable performance.

Why it works: Aligns with external motivation, visible status, and clear KPIs.

Case: A regional sales team introduced tiered badges for deal size thresholds and a monthly top-performer badge. Adoption rose 38% and conversion improved, but initial metric gaming required added checks for returns and cancellations.

Customer Support — Quality-and-streak pattern

Pattern: Combine speed badges with quality streak badges and peer-nominated empathy awards.

Why it works: Balances throughput with quality and nurtures relatedness via peer recognition.

Case: A support center replaced single-metric badges with composite badges (FCR + CSAT) and saw CSAT rise while average handle time stayed stable.

HR — Learning and mastery pattern

Pattern: Badges for training completion, demonstration of skills, and internal coaching credentials.

Why it works: Supports intrinsic motivation and career progression without public competition.

Case: HR used badges as evidence in internal mobility decisions; employees valued private skill badges more than public leaderboards.

Finance & Compliance — Accuracy-first pattern

Pattern: Badges that reward error-free streaks, audit-readiness, and peer-reviewed approvals.

Why it works: Emphasizes risk mitigation and competence while discouraging speed-over-quality.

Case: The finance team added accuracy-tier badges tied to audit scores; these had slower initial uptake but reduced reconciliations by 22% over six months.

R&D — Mastery and mentorship pattern

Pattern: Private progress badges for learning, public mentorship badges, and contribution badges for substantial technical reviews.

Why it works: Preserves autonomy, promotes competence, and encourages knowledge-sharing without competitive pressure.

Case: An engineering org used mentorship badges that required mentee sign-off. The result was increased cross-team pairing and faster ramp times for new hires.

Rollout checklist

Before launch, run through this practical checklist. Each item reduces risk and improves the chance that badges influence real outcomes rather than surface metrics.

  1. Define the specific behavior and tie it to a measurable KPI.
  2. Conduct a motivation diagnostic for target teams.
  3. Design 2–4 badge types and decide visibility settings.
  4. Plan a timeboxed pilot with clear evaluation criteria.
  5. Implement quality guards and anti-gaming rules.
  6. Measure both behavior and sentiment; iterate for 2–3 cycles.
  7. Document badge taxonomy and communication plan for scale.

Quick governance tip: Establish a small cross-functional panel (product, HR, analytics) to review badge proposals and evidence to prevent siloed rollouts that create inconsistent incentives.
